Should you play it?

DRAGON BALL XENOVERSE revisits famous battles from the series through your custom Avatar and other classic characters. New features include the mysterious Toki Toki City, new gameplay mechanics, new animations and many other amazing features!

What works

  • Extensive character customization
  • Engaging story mode with time travel
  • Cooperative multiplayer missions
  • Faithful anime-style graphics and soundtrack
  • Long playtime with side quests and progression

Things to keep in mind

  • Grinding and rng-based item drops
  • Online servers and matchmaking issues
  • Limited roster and missing transformations
  • Some ai and balance problems
  • Repetitive mission structure
